- Try Not To Step Out Of The House Much:
While it is not safe for anyone to step out of their houses a lot these days, for new mothers it is absolutely imperative that they do not step out of their house unless it is of utmost importance as this can lead to them carrying certain germs and infections back to their infant at home. These little babies are more susceptible to these diseases as compared to us so it is no joke to keep them well protected from such outside germs as their body’s immunity has not been built properly yet.

- Minimise Contact Of Outsiders With Your Baby:
While it may not be completely possible to keep your baby away from everyone who is visiting your house, but that does not mean that you can not take proper precautions to safeguard the health of your child. A good way to do this would be to not let other people hold the baby and instead make them meet him or her from a good distance to keep away the chances of any kind of infections. Also, make it a point to sanitise every person who enters your house in a proper and thorough way so that no germs are allowed to enter inside your doorstep.

- Sterilise All Utensils And Equipments That Are Used In The Vicinity Of The Baby:
Now this is a tip which needs no introduction as every new mother already knows the importance of sterilizing all the utensils and devices which come in contact with the baby on a regular basis, sometimes even multiple times in one day. This is a step which can not be overlooked at all or its importance undermined in any way, shape or form. Doing this extra effort can actually save your child from getting exposed to harmful chemicals, germs and hence, the diseases that they carry with them.
